I installed Pex in a bathroom I am remodeling and used the Apollo crimp fittings from Lowes. I used the Apollo tool to install the crimps.
When I used the go no go tool to check the install the tool fits against the crimp one way and at another angle fits properly. Most all the crimps fit this way.
Would you consider this too tight?
Is an uneven fitting susceptible to failure?
None of the connections are leaking, but I worry about the potential for failure in the future.
Am I just being paranoid, or should I reinstall?
